American English Coonhound Weight Overview

Adult American English Coonhounds typically weigh between 45 and 65 pounds, with males generally being larger than females. Males average 45–65 lbs while females typically weigh 38–57 lbs.

Weighs 45 to 65 pounds; they are the most lean and athletic of the coonhound breeds, built for speed and endurance..

When Does a American English Coonhound Stop Growing?

Most American English Coonhounds reach adult height of 23–26 inches by 12–15 months, with full body weight of 45–65 lbs achieved shortly after. Males fill out to 65 lbs while females reach 57 lbs.

Is My American English Coonhound Overweight?

Is your American English Coonhound at a healthy weight? The ideal range is 45–65 lbs (males 45–65, females 38–57). Check these three signs:

  • Ribs: Easily felt with light pressure; not visible but not buried under fat
  • Waistline: A clear narrowing behind the ribs when viewed from above
  • Abdominal tuck: The belly slopes upward from the ribcage to the hind legs when viewed from the side

Feeding Recommendation

Adult American English Coonhounds (45–65 lbs) typically need 0.7 to 1.3 cups of high-quality dry food per day, divided into two meals. A formula suited to medium breeds provides appropriate nutrient density. Weight by Age Table

AgeMale (lbs)Female (lbs)
3 months 14.7–17.8 12.5–15.1
6 months 32.4–39.1 27.5–33.3
9 months 47.2–56.8 40.0–48.4
12 months 59.0–71.0 50.0–60.5

Poor weight gain in a American English Coonhound puppy warrants a vet visit. For a breed that should reach 45–65 lbs at maturity, slow growth can signal parasites (very common in puppies), underfeeding, food intolerance, or illness. Regular weigh-ins help track progress objectively. Your vet will likely run a fecal test and blood work.
